Need advice navigating group dynamics

I’ve had a rocky but ultimately survivable run as an analyst in a sweaty, political group with too many sub-niches. Twice, I was shielded by seniors on my vertical, but with shifting dynamics I don’t think that protection will last. Right now, I have zero visibility — I’m stuck under a super-controlling associate who prefers to work directly with other juniors, essentially bypassing me and making my role irrelevant in the chain of command.

Shifting into another vertical seems impossible — those spots are crowded and already have their “favorite” analysts. I’ve got about six months until the next review cycle, which could be the final cut. The job market feels brutal, internal transfer options don’t interest me, and I feel sick being stuck in this seat. I can’t move on, but I also can’t stand how miserable I feel here.
